
A covert government initiative seeks to replicate the infamous Philadelphia Experiment, a World War II project aiming to cloak warships. When the experiment unexpectedly succeeds, the original ship, the USS Eldridge, vanishes and reappears decades later, unleashing chaos and destruction upon the present day. A lone survivor of the initial test and his granddaughter must work together to prevent further devastation and uncover the truth behind the disastrous event.

In 1943, aboard a United States Navy destroyer escort docked in Philadelphia, a top‑secret experiment is conducted with the goal of making the ship invisible to radar. The operation is led by a brilliant but enigmatic scientist and his team, who push the boundaries of physics in an attempt to render the vessel imperceptible to the world. As the test unfolds, a dangerous malfunction erupts, and the Eldridge abruptly vanishes from sight. The two sailors on board—driven by a mix of training, courage, and fear—try to halt the procedure, but their efforts fail. In a desperate bid for survival, they leap overboard as alarms scream and the ship fades from reality.
What follows is a bewildering tumble through time and space. The men awaken to a strange night, finding themselves in a small town that exists for only a moment before it vanishes, leaving them marooned in a harsh desert landscape. The night air carries the shadow of an unfamiliar helicopter, and an electric fence nearly zaps one of them into oblivion. They stumble to a roadside diner, where an energy discharge from one of the men wrecks two arcade games and provokes a heated confrontation with the wary owner. In a frantic bid to escape, they seize a woman and force her to drive them away, jolting awake to the realization that the year is now 1984. The new surroundings feel impossible, and the two men are soon hunted by the police. One man experiences escalating seizures, is hospitalized, and then vanishes in a sudden flash of light, leaving the other to dodge military pursuit and scramble to understand what has happened.
With time and distance fracturing their sense of reality, the remaining man discovers that he is near Santa Paula, California—Jim’s birthplace—and begins a search for any possible link to a life that should have been long behind him. Jim’s wife, now an elderly woman, recognizes the newcomer instantly and confirms a chilling truth: the Eldridge had reappeared moments after vanishing, and Jim had briefly returned to tell the tale before being chastised and kept from the truth. Yet the man himself never returned. A high‑speed chase erupts through Jim’s ranch as military police close in, but the fugitives manage a perilous escape when the pursuing vehicle crashes in flames. From the wreckage, documents hint at a scientist’s involvement in the Philadelphia affair, reigniting the resolve to uncover the hidden mechanism behind it all. A bond forms between the two fugitives as they share stories and begin to lean on one another for survival and companionship.
As the timeline collapses into 1984, the scientist who sparked the initial project pushes forward with plans to shield a city from an ICBM attack, believing this technology can be repurposed to protect the world. When his tests trigger a catastrophic “hyperspace” vortex, reality itself seems to unravel: the town and its people slip into a shimmering void as extreme weather and strange phenomena swirl around them. A probe sent into the vortex reveals the Eldridge trapped within, and the scientists deduce that the two experiments are linked through the power of the Eldridge’s generators. The revelation reframes the mission: to save the Earth, someone must reenter the vortex and shut down the original system.
A desperate rescue operation unfolds as one man is fortified with a protective suit and propelled through the vortex to the deck of the Eldridge. The injured crew there are found, and the generator room becomes a battlefield of ingenuity and bravery. With a firefighting axe, the protagonist smashes a series of vacuum tubes, halting the generator’s pull and bringing the ship’s systems back under control. The moment he confirms that the other sailor is alive, he dives back into danger, vanishing from the ship and into the dangers of the vortex itself. The consequences ripple across time: in 1943, the Eldridge reappears in Philadelphia, its crew bearing burns and injuries, with some crew fused to the hull by the strange process. In 1984, the town that vanished returns to the world, and the bond between the two strangers is sealed as they are finally reunited.
